The global Anti-Microbial Edible Packaging Market is gaining significant traction, projected to grow from USD 1.1 billion in 2025 to USD 3.8 billion by 2035, expanding at a remarkable CAGR of 13.5%. This represents a 3.5X market expansion, driven by the convergence of sustainability demands, food safety concerns, and material science innovation. The market’s growth story is rooted in a critical global challenge reducing food waste while eliminating plastic dependency making antimicrobial edible packaging one of the most disruptive innovations in the packaging industry.

Segment Insights: Polysaccharide Films and Natural Extracts Lead Innovation

The polysaccharide-based films segment dominates with 42.0% market share, driven by their natural origin, biodegradability, and excellent film-forming properties. Materials such as chitosan, alginate, and cellulose derivatives are widely used across food applications.

Meanwhile, natural plant extracts account for 46.0% of antimicrobial agents, reflecting strong consumer preference for clean-label solutions.

The dairy and dairy alternatives segment leads with 36.0% share, where edible coatings help prevent microbial growth while preserving product freshness and quality.
